Product Overview
Vulcan Hart 00-958827-000G3 OEM Oven High-Limit Replacement Assembly
The Vulcan Hart 00-958827-000G3 Oven High-Limit Replacement Assembly is an OEM safety-control component designed for compatible Vulcan commercial cooking equipment. The high-limit assembly provides critical over-temperature protection by interrupting the heating circuit when equipment temperature exceeds the designed safe operating limit.
Unlike the oven's normal operating thermostat or electronic temperature controller, the 00-958827-000G3 high limit functions as a safety device. It is not intended to regulate normal cooking temperature. If an abnormal over-temperature condition occurs, the high-limit control helps stop continued heating and protects the equipment from excessive heat.

Operating Thermostat vs. High-Limit Safety Control
It is important to distinguish the high-limit control from the oven's normal operating thermostat.
The operating thermostat or electronic temperature controller regulates temperature during normal cooking. The high-limit control is a separate safety device designed to respond when temperature rises beyond the intended operating range.
A high-limit trip can therefore be a symptom of another equipment problem rather than proof that the high-limit assembly itself has failed.
Common High-Limit Replacement Situations
Qualified commercial cooking-equipment technicians may inspect or replace the Vulcan Hart 00-958827-000G3 when diagnosing conditions such as:
- Oven will not heat after an over-temperature event
- High-limit safety circuit remains open
- Heating system shuts down unexpectedly
- Repeated high-limit activation
- Intermittent heating associated with the safety circuit
- Visible damage to the high-limit assembly
- Damaged sensing components
- Loose, burned, or overheated electrical terminals
- Damaged capillary or sensing assembly
- High-limit control fails electrical testing
These conditions should be properly diagnosed before replacing the component. If the high limit has opened because the oven actually overheated, the cause of the excessive temperature must also be identified and corrected.
Why Does an Oven High Limit Trip?
A high-limit control may activate because of an actual over-temperature condition elsewhere in the equipment. Depending on the oven configuration, technicians may need to investigate:
- Failed or inaccurate operating thermostat
- Temperature-control malfunction
- Relay or contactor remaining energized
- Temperature sensor or sensing problem
- Incorrect sensing-component placement
- Wiring or electrical faults
- Control-system malfunction
- Heating components remaining energized
- Airflow or circulation problems where applicable
Repeatedly replacing or resetting a high-limit control without correcting the cause of overheating can result in continued equipment shutdowns and may create an unsafe operating condition.

Inspect the Sensing Assembly Carefully
The sensing portion of a mechanical high-limit control is critical to proper operation. During diagnosis and installation, inspect the sensing assembly for physical damage and verify that it is positioned and routed correctly.
Look for conditions such as:
- Kinked or crushed capillary tubing
- Sharp bends
- Damaged sensing bulb
- Incorrect sensing-bulb position
- Loose mounting
- Heat damage
- Damage caused during previous service
Do not cut, splice, sharply bend, or modify a capillary or sensing assembly. Damage can affect the operation of the temperature safety control.

Installation & Service Notes
Disconnect electrical power and follow the equipment manufacturer's service procedures before servicing the oven. Allow hot surfaces and internal components to cool to a safe temperature before beginning work.
Before removing the original high-limit assembly, document the location of electrical connections, mounting hardware, and the routing and position of the sensing components.
Install the replacement assembly using the correct mounting arrangement and carefully route the sensing assembly without kinking, crushing, sharply bending, cutting, or otherwise damaging it.
Before returning the oven to normal operation, determine whether another component or control problem caused the original high-limit activation. After installation, test the equipment through an appropriate operating cycle and verify normal temperature control and safety-system operation.
Because this component is part of an oven safety circuit, diagnosis and installation should be performed by qualified commercial cooking-equipment service personnel.

Is this the normal oven thermostat?
No. The high limit is a safety control. The normal operating thermostat or temperature controller regulates cooking temperature, while the high limit provides protection against an abnormal over-temperature condition.
Can a bad high limit cause a no-heat condition?
An open high-limit safety circuit can prevent continued heating. However, technicians should determine whether the high limit itself has failed or opened because of an actual overheating condition.
Why does my Vulcan oven keep tripping the high limit?
Repeated high-limit activation can indicate an underlying temperature-control, sensor, relay, contactor, wiring, heating, or airflow problem. The root cause should be diagnosed before replacing components.
Should I replace the operating thermostat when replacing the high limit?
Not automatically. The operating thermostat should be tested to determine whether it is controlling temperature correctly. Replace only components confirmed to be defective or outside the manufacturer's specifications.
Can a stuck relay or contactor trip the high limit?
If a heating-control component remains energized when it should open, excessive temperature may result and cause the high-limit safety system to activate.
Should I inspect the sensing assembly before installation?
Yes. Inspect the sensing components and capillary where applicable for kinks, crushing, sharp bends, physical damage, and correct positioning.
Can I bypass the high-limit control?
No. A high-limit control is an equipment safety device and should not be bypassed for normal operation.
